About Jonathan W.C. Wong
Jonathan W.C. Wong is a scholar working on Pollution, Building and Construction, Biomedical Engineering, Industrial and Manufacturing Engineering and Water Science and Technology, having authored 397 papers that have together received 18.5k indexed citations. Recurring topics across this work include Anaerobic Digestion and Biogas Production (71 papers), Composting and Vermicomposting Techniques (50 papers), Heavy metals in environment (45 papers), Biofuel production and bioconversion (35 papers), Coal and Its By-products (31 papers), Phosphorus and nutrient management (31 papers), Wastewater Treatment and Nitrogen Removal (31 papers) and Microbial bioremediation and biosurfactants (29 papers). The work is most often cited by research in Pollution (6.3k citations), Industrial and Manufacturing Engineering (4.3k citations), Soil Science (4.4k citations), Building and Construction (3.7k citations) and Geochemistry and Petrology (1.2k citations). Jonathan W.C. Wong has collaborated with scholars based in Hong Kong, China and India. Frequent co-authors include Ammaiyappan Selvam, Ming Hung Wong, Sunita Varjani, Min Fang, Zhenyong Zhao, Qi‐Tang Wu, Bharat Nagar, Liwen Luo, Ka Yu Cheng and Ying Zhou. Their work appears in journals such as Bioresource Technology, Environmental Technology, Chemosphere, Water Air & Soil Pollution and Journal of Hazardous Materials.
